Technical Art Director

to join our studio in Boston to work on Project Orion, the follow-up to Cyberpunk 2077 and the next major video game in the Cyberpunk franchise. The Technical Art Director will work with other leads and directors to drive our tools development and pipelines for art, deliver on techniques to hit visual excellence, as well as managing VFX and Technical animation resources.
